Uber-IPO

Many people own an Uber app on their smartphone. But you can soon be able to own a piece of the company — by becoming a shareholder. The online ride-hailing giant has filed confidential preliminary paperwork for selling stock to the public. Word of this comes in a report over the weekend in The Wall Street Journal. The newspaper reports Uber filed the documents last week. The timing indicates a public offering may come within the first three months of next year. Uber declined to comment on the Journal report.
